The components of this languageits shapes, lines, colours, tones, and texturesare utilized in various ways to generate sensations of volume, area, activity, and light on a flat surface area. These elements are integrated right into meaningful patterns in order to represent genuine or supernatural sensations, to analyze a narrative theme, or to develop entirely abstract visual partnerships.
Later the concept of the "great artist" established in Asia and Renaissance Europe. Famous painters were paid for the social standing of scholars and courtiers; they authorized their job, decided its style and typically its subject and images, and developed an extra personalif not constantly amicablerelationship with their patrons. During the 19th century painters check this in Western societies began to lose their social setting and safe patronage.

Do not duplicate the style of other artists if you're trying to find your design. Duplicating other individuals's art work can be great in instructional objectives but it will certainly not make you closer to discovering your own special style. Your creative design has to be, what you such as and what influences you.
I would certainly consider your very own style as a style you repaint in normally, when you let go of all ideas and regulations and just concentrate on painting, not thinking of it. Unique Art. The style has to come naturally to you when you are unwinded and you can't require it or it will not be your very own style, just another person's
